Understanding Ignition Repair: A Comprehensive Guide
Ignition systems are vital parts of any automobile's operation. They are accountable for starting the engine and ensuring it runs efficiently. Gradually, however, ignition systems can experience wear and tear, requiring repair. This post explores ignition repair: its value, indications of ignition failure, typical repair techniques, and the expenses associated with repair.
What is Ignition Repair?
Ignition repair includes fixing or changing elements of the ignition system that are stopping working or have failed. The ignition system typically consists of:
Ignition coilsGlow plugsIgnition wiresDistributor capsIgnition switches
When these aspects breakdown, they can result in starting issues or poor engine efficiency.

Signs of Ignition System Failure
Being aware of the indications of ignition system failure can help automobile owners address problems quickly. Typical symptoms consist of:
Difficulty Starting the Engine: The engine may crank gradually or not begin at all.Engine Misfires: The engine might stutter or shake throughout velocity.Decreased Fuel Efficiency: A drop in mileage can suggest ignition problems.Rough Idling: The automobile might shake or vibrate while idling.Inspect Engine Light: A lit check engine light can signal various issues, consisting of ignition issues.
If anybody experiences any of these signs, it is a good idea to look for expert help for diagnostics and possible repairs.
Typical Ignition System Repairs
Ignition repairs can vary widely in regards to intricacy and cost. Below is a list of common ignition system repairs:
Spark Plug Replacement: Often the initial step if basic misfiring happens.Ignition Coil Replacement: If stimulate plugs are operating well, the ignition coil may require replacement.Ignition Wires Replacement: Worn or broken wires can hinder performance and need changing.Supplier Cap Replacement: In older cars, changing a faulty supplier cap might be needed.Ignition Switch Repair or Replacement: If the vehicle won't begin at all, the ignition switch might be at fault.
Here is an overview of these common repairs in the type of a table:
Repair TypeDescriptionTypical Cost (GBP)Spark Plug ReplacementChanging worn or damaged spark plugs.₤ 100 - ₤ 300Ignition Coil ReplacementChanging the coils that move electrical power to the trigger plugs.₤ 150 - ₤ 400Ignition Wires ReplacementReplacing old ignition wires to make sure proper connection.₤ 100 - ₤ 200Supplier Cap ReplacementReplacing or fixing the supplier cap and rotor for older vehicles.₤ 150 - ₤ 250Ignition Key Switch RepairRepair or replace the defective ignition switch.₤ 100 - ₤ 300
Note: Prices may differ based on car make, design, and labor expenses in various regions.
How to Maintain Your Ignition System
Routine upkeep is key to avoiding ignition system failures. Here are a number of ideas to think about:
Regularly Check Spark Plugs: Inspect and replace trigger plugs every 30,000 to 100,000 miles, depending upon the type.Inspect Ignition Coils: Look for indications of wear or damage and replace as essential.Replace Ignition Wires: Make sure wires are undamaged and devoid of corrosion.Keep Battery in Good Condition: A weak battery can impact ignition efficiency.Perform Regular Diagnostics: Utilize onboard diagnostics or expert services to examine for any warning signals.FAQs About Ignition Repair
